AFCON 2023: Super Eagles players appreciate Ibrahim Sangare's generosity towards Nigerian journalists and fans in Ivory Coast
Sangare's act of sponsoring over 100 journalists/bloggers and more than 100 fans to Bouake, a 5-hour journey from Abidjan, to witness the thrilling encounter exemplifies the spirit of camaraderie and unity within the football community.

The Super Eagles, Nigeria's national football team, were set to face South Africa in a highly anticipated semifinal match. However, what made this encounter even more special was Sangare's initiative to ensure that both journalists/bloggers and fans had the opportunity to be part of the excitement.
By sponsoring their journey to Bouake, Sangare enabled them to witness the match firsthand, creating unforgettable memories and strengthening the bond between the fans and the sport as reported by Ojora Babatunde on X.

During his visit to the Super Eagles camp, Sangare also had the opportunity to meet with key figures in Nigerian football, including the President of the Nigerian Football Federation (NFF), Alh. Ibrahim Gusau, and Daniel Amokachi, further strengthening the ties between the Nigerian and Ivorian football communities.
